We are seeking a highly motivated Research Assistant to join our gonococcal genomics research team within the Nuffield Department of Population Health, University of Oxford.
This is an exciting opportunity for an early career researcher with a background in bioinformatics, microbiology, genomics, biology, computer science or a related field to contribute to research investigating Neisseria gonorrhoeae, antimicrobial resistance (AMR), vaccine antigen diversity and pathogen evolution. The appointee will work closely with members of a multidisciplinary research team, using a collection of more than 60,000 gonococcal genomes to support large-scale genomic analyses with direct relevance to AMR surveillance and vaccine development.
The main responsibilities will include managing and analysing whole-genome sequence data, developing and applying bioinformatics workflows to annotate antimicrobial resistance determinants and vaccine antigen genes, and conducting analyses of genomic diversity, population structure and evolutionary patterns. The postholder will curate and quality control genomic datasets and associated metadata, interpret analytical results, and prepare summaries, figures and reports for research meetings and publications. Additional duties will include contributing to manuscripts, conference presentations and other dissemination activities, working with researchers across the group and external collaborators, and supporting wider academic activities within the Department, including teaching, student mentoring and supervision where appropriate.
You will hold a degree in bioinformatics, microbiology, genomics, biology, computer science or a closely related discipline, and have experience analysing biological or genomic datasets using computational methods. You will have familiarity with Linux/Unix command-line environments and scripting languages such as Python, R or Bash, together with knowledge of microbial genomics and/or bacterial whole-genome sequencing and experience using bioinformatics software and data analysis workflows. You will also have excellent organisational and communication skills, the ability to manage your own research and administrative activities, and the ability to work both independently and collaboratively as part of a multidisciplinary research team. Experience with bacterial population or comparative genomics, antimicrobial resistance prediction or bacterial genome annotation tools, large-scale genomic datasets or high-performance computing environments would be advantageous.
